public Object call(Context cx, Scriptable scope, Scriptable thisObj, Object[] args) { // This XMLList is being called as a Function. // Let's find the real Function object. if(targetProperty == null) throw ScriptRuntime.notFunctionError(this); String methodName = targetProperty.getLocalName(); boolean isApply = methodName.equals("apply"); if(isApply || methodName.equals("call")) return applyOrCall(isApply, cx, scope, thisObj, args); Callable method = ScriptRuntime.getElemFunctionAndThis( this, methodName, cx); // Call lastStoredScriptable to clear stored thisObj // but ignore the result as the method should use the supplied // thisObj, not one from redirected call ScriptRuntime.lastStoredScriptable(cx); return method.call(cx, scope, thisObj, args); }
/** * Method used to run a command through the Rhino engine. Allows to have a single generic executeCommand * public static method (signature needed by Rhino) for all the commands. * The command function registered to the top-level contains a reference to the actual command to be run, * which is a {@link Command} object annotated with the {@link ExecutableCommand} annotation. * @param cx the Rhino context * @param thisObj the current scope * @param args The arguments provided when running the command as a javascript function * @param funObj The function invoked through the shell * @return the result of the command execution */ @SuppressWarnings("unused") public static Object executeCommand(Context cx, Scriptable thisObj, Object[] args, Function funObj) { if (funObj instanceof RhinoCommandFunctionObject) { RhinoCommandFunctionObject rhinoCommandFunctionObject = (RhinoCommandFunctionObject) funObj; Scriptable parentScope = rhinoCommandFunctionObject.getParentScope(); Command command = rhinoCommandFunctionObject.getCommand(); ExecutableCommand annotation = command.getClass().getAnnotation(ExecutableCommand.class); Callable callable = ScriptRuntime.getPropFunctionAndThis(command, annotation.executeMethod(), cx, parentScope); return callable.call(cx, parentScope, ScriptRuntime.lastStoredScriptable(cx), args); } throw new RuntimeException("Unable to determine the command to run"); } }
